DataFaucet 1.0 Beta

datafaucet.system.sql
Class insertablestatement

WEB-INF.cftags.component
        extended by datafaucet.system.sql.duck
            extended by datafaucet.system.sql.simplefiltergroup
                extended by datafaucet.system.sql.filtergroup
                    extended by datafaucet.system.sql.statement
                        extended by datafaucet.system.sql.insertablestatement
Direct Known Subclasses:
insert , update

public class insertablestatement
extends statement

extended by insert and update to manage insert data


Constructor Summary
init()
 
Method Summary
 any getColumn(string columnName)
 any increment(string columnName, [numeric amount='1'])
 any incrementDate(string columnName, [numeric amount='1'], [string datepart='d'])
 any setColumn(string columnName, any columnValue)
private void set_insertData(string propertyname, struct propertyvalue)
 
Methods inherited from class datafaucet.system.sql.statement
addListener, bindFilters, broadcast, clearJoinTables, clearListeners, clearUnions, execute, getColumnList, getColumns, getDatasource, getGroupSource, getListeners, getNewListener, getSQLAgent, getSource, getSourceName, getSyntax, getTable, get_alias, hasFilters, hasGroupSource, hasJoinTables, hasListeners, initStatement, notifyListener, reset, setDatasource, set_datasource, set_table
 
Methods inherited from class datafaucet.system.sql.filtergroup
addLiquidFilterGroup, addLiquidFilters, andOrCollectionFilter, andOrFilter, caseSensitiveFilter, collectionFilter, dateFilter, filter, filterGroup, filterLanguage, filterLocale, getDefaultLocale, getLiquidNameArray, getLocaleArray, getNewFilter, listFilter, nullFilter, numericFilter, onMissingMethod, reverseFilter, setFirstFilter, sqlFilter, timeSpanFilter
 
Methods inherited from class datafaucet.system.sql.simplefiltergroup
appendFilter, clearFilters, columnNotFoundException, filtersExist, getAvailableColumnList, getFilters, getFirstFilter, getTableArray, getTableForColumn, get_column, hasJoinSource, isGroup, makeFilters, raiseFilterExceptions, setTable, typeMismatchException
 
Methods inherited from class datafaucet.system.sql.duck
arg, getDefaultLocalization, getLocalization, getNext, getObject, getProperties, getProperty, getPropertylist, getTail, getValue, hasNext, identifyAccessorOrMutator, insertAfter, parseDate, parseNumber, raiseAbstractClassException, raiseMissingMethodException, removeAfter, setLocalization, setNext, setProperties, setProperty, setValue, simplify
 
Methods inherited from class WEB-INF.cftags.component
 

Constructor Detail

init

public init()

Method Detail

getColumn

public any getColumn(string columnName)

Parameters:
columnName

increment

public any increment(string columnName, [numeric amount='1'])

Parameters:
columnName
amount

incrementDate

public any incrementDate(string columnName, [numeric amount='1'], [string datepart='d'])

Parameters:
columnName
amount
datepart

setColumn

public any setColumn(string columnName, any columnValue)

Parameters:
columnName
columnValue

set_insertData

private void set_insertData(string propertyname, struct propertyvalue)

Parameters:
propertyname
propertyvalue

DataFaucet 1.0 Beta